Workspace ONE XR Hub Release Notes describe the new features and enhancements in each release. This page contains a summary of the new capabilities, issues that have been resolved, and known issues that have been reported.

Use Workspace ONE XR Hub as a companion to Omnissa Workspace ONE Intelligent Hub to provide an enterprise experience and cross-platform native launcher for Virtual Reality (VR) devices. XR Hub works with Workspace ONE UEM to provide secure access to native VR, remote VR, WebXR, Web, SaaS and VDI applications and shared device check-in/check-out functionality. XR Hub can also be used with Workspace ONE Access to provide advanced authentication and unified application catalog purposes.

Workspace ONE XR Hub 25.03.1

New Features

  • Added support for reporting the following Meta Quest device attributes (using Custom Attributes) to Workspace ONE UEM
    • Controller Battery Levels
    • Meta Quest OS Version

Minimum Requirements

  • XR Devices
    • Supported HTC VIVE, Meta Quest (v74+) and PICO VR devices.
  • XR Hub Configuration & XR Device Management
    • Omnissa Workspace ONE UEM 23.06+
    • Workspace ONE Intelligent Hub for Android 23.10+
  • Unified Application Catalog
    • Omnissa Workspace ONE Access 22.10+
  • Horizon Desktop / App Access in XR Hub
    • Omnissa Horizon 23.11+
  • Remote Rendering and VR App Streaming
    • NVIDIA CloudXR v3.1+ (CloudXR client included in downloads)
    • (Optional) XR Hub Cloud Link [Tech Preview]
    • (Optional) Omnissa Horizon [Tech Preview]
  • Single Sign-On
    • Omnissa Workspace ONE Access
    • Omnissa Workspace ONE Tunnel
  • Per App VPN
    • Omnissa Workspace ONE Tunnel
    • Omnissa Unified Application Gateway (UAG)

Resolved Issues

  • Fixed issue where Meta Quest controller battery levels and Meta Quest OS version were not correctly reported to Workspace ONE UEM.
  • Fixed issue where XR Hub failed to send logs to UEM.

Known Issues

  • Using Workspace ONE Access to publish CloudXR applications (using a machines IP address) can cause a 30 second delay in launching the CloudXR application from XR Hub.

Workspace ONE XR Hub 25.03

New Features

  • Support for native kiosk mode on Meta Quest devices
    • Meta Quest Horizon OS now offers a native kiosk mode with firmware version v74
    • XR Hub can now be configured using the OEMConfig,apk as the kiosk mode application
    • XR Hub configuration has been updated to support native kiosk mode
    • The old XR Hub kiosk mode mechanism has been deprecated.
  • Support for user PIN code on Pico devices

Workspace ONE XR Hub 24.11

New Features

  • IMPORTANT! Changed package name / bundleID to com.ws1.xr.xrhub.<platform>
    • You MUST uninstall the old version of XR Hub before installing XR Hub 24.11. You must recreate application configuration settings in UEM for this new application.
  • Updated to Omnissa branded logos and text.
  • Add Legal Center window to the legal sub options under the user menu.
  • Fixed getting stuck on Loading Environment... when using custom logo environment.
  • Ensure background apps are killed when returning to XR Hub when using Quest kiosk mode so that their audio does not continue to play.
  • Fix Quest kiosk mode not working when its a newly uploaded application on UEM.
  • Fix Remember Me option on Login Window not always repopulating the remembered username in certain cases.
  • Show download progress bar on Tutorial Window when the video is still being downloaded and fix the window getting stuck in a loading state.
  • Minor legal-related text changes relating to transition to Omnissa.

Known Issues

  • Using Workspace ONE Access to publish CloudXR applications (using a machines IP address) can cause a 30 second delay in launching the CloudXR application from XR Hub.
  • Kiosk mode is in Tech Preview for Meta Quest devices as Meta does not support a native Kiosk Mode for Meta Quest devices.
  • Omnissa implements some of the typical Kiosk mode functionality for Meta Quest devices with XR Hub, but the following limitations should be noted:
    • Kiosk Mode requires “developer mode” physical access to the device to run ADB commands.
    • XR Hub requires delegated administration rights from Workspace ONE UEM.
    • Device must be in passthrough mode for kiosk mode.
    • There might be a delay between device boot and triggering of kiosk mode.
    • Access to Wi-Fi and Bluetooth settings are blocked after kiosk mode is triggered.

Workspace ONE XR Hub 24.06

New Features

  • Exit Kiosk Mode on Meta Quest devices using an Admin PIN Code.
  • Improved Kiosk Mode on Meta Quest devices.
  • Give admins and users option to cache username on login page.
  • Option to start XR Hub in passthrough mode on devices that support passthrough.
  • Added support for CloudXR 4.0
